Q-omics provides the consensus-scored TRAV31 profile across patient tissues and cancer cell-line models. TRAV31 expression is associated with patient survival in 11 of 34 cancer types, with the highest sampling consensus in READ. Among the 18 cancer types available for tumor–normal comparison, TRAV31 is differentially expressed in 3, with the highest sampling consensus in KIRC. Additionally, TRAV31 RNA expression shows 7,358 significant gene co-expression associations, with the highest sampling consensus in LAML. Together, these results highlight READ, KIRC, and LAML as cancer lineages where TRAV31 shows reproducible signals across survival, tumor–normal expression, and patient cross-omics analyses.

Every result is evaluated using two consensus scores. Sampling consensus measures how consistently a finding is reproduced within a cancer lineage across different conditions. Lineage consensus measures how broadly the result is shared across cancer types, distinguishing pan-cancer signals from lineage-specific patterns.

This table ranks reproducible TRAV31 RNA expression–survival associations across cancer types. High TRAV31 expression shows unfavorable associations in READ, CESC, GBM, STAD and BRCA, but favorable associations in LAML. The READ Kaplan–Meier curve shows clear separation, with the high-expression group declining faster, consistent with the unfavorable association (log-rank p = .004). Together, the overview and detailed table identify READ as the clearest survival context for TRAV31 RNA expression.
